German Potato Salad Recipe
  • Prep/Total Time: 30 min.
  • Yield: 12-14 Servings

Ingredients

  • 12 medium potatoes
  • 12 bacon strips
  • 1-1/2 cups chopped onion
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 1 tablespo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on celery seed
  • 1 teaspoon ground mustard
  • Pinch pepper
  • 1-1/2 cups water
  • 3/4 cup white vinegar
  • Chopped fresh parsley

Directions

  • Place potatoes in a large saucepan and cover with water.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and cook for 15-20 minutes or until tender. Drain. Peel and slice into a large bowl; set aside.
  • In a large skillet, cook bacon until crisp. Using a slotted spoon, remove bacon to paper towels; drain, reserving 2 tablespoons drippings.
  • Saute onion in drippings until tender. Stir in the next six ingredients. Gradually stir in water and vinegar; bring to a boil, stirring constantly. Cook and stir 2 minutes more or until thickened. Pour over potatoes; toss to coat. Crumble bacon and gently stir into potatoes. Sprinkle with parsley. Yield: 12-14 servings.

Nutritional Facts 1 serving (3/4 cup) equals 244 calories, 11 g fat (4 g saturated fat), 13 mg cholesterol, 652 mg sodium, 32 g carbohydrate, 2 g fiber, 4 g protein.
